The Norman Broadbent Global Public Transport Outlook 2026 noted that “decision making in public transport often slows as ownership fragments across sponsors, operators, authorities and delivery bodies”.
When a bus lane project requires sign-off from transport agencies, local councils, environmental authorities, and finance ministries, the result is not rigorous oversightโit is paralysis. This fragmentation creates what researchers call the “implementation gap.” In New Zealand, a study published in Case Studies on Transport Policy found that even when strategic goals are aligned at the policy level, “funding misalignment and governance complexities hinder active travel collaboration”. The disconnect between grand visions and delivery pathways means sustainability strategies remain stuck on paper.
It is even more complicated in the United States, where the research reveals that 66 percent of major transit projects cross multiple municipal boundaries. This creates a
political free-for-all. Mayors and city councillors with no official role in project
governance nonetheless wield enormous informal power, leveraging relationships to
demand changes that add millions to budgets and years to timelines. One
Minneapolis mayor successfully argued for a rerouting that added $200 million to the
Metro Green Line’s cost.
If governance is the first bottleneck, technology is the second. The problem is not
that we lack sophisticated tools. It is that the public sector, which runs most of the
world’s mass transit, is stuck in the technological dark ages. As Amos Haggiag of
Optibus argues forcefully in METRO Magazine, “many transit authorities instead rely
on decades-old software and manual practices”. While venture capitalists pour
billions into autonomous vehicles and ride-hailing appsโservices that primarily serve
the wealthy and worsen congestionโthe systems that move the masses are
managed with spreadsheets and guesswork. This technological deficit has real
consequences. Poor scheduling, unreliable real-time information, and suboptimal
route planning drive passengers into the waiting arms of Uber and Grab. A University
of California-Davis study found that up to 61 percent of ride-hailing trips replaced
public transport, walking, or cycling. The technology gap is not just an
inconvenience; it is actively cannibalising the ridership base that sustains public
transport.
Yet there is hope. The European Union’s UPPER project is demonstrating what
happens when cities embrace digitalisation. By deploying intelligent transport
systems, GPS tracking, and data-driven planning, cities like Budapest have
redesigned their networks to respond to actual demand patterns. The lesson is
simple but profound: you cannot manage what you cannot measure.
Perhaps the most fascinating insight from recent research challenges our
fundamental assumptions about how transport should be organised. A
groundbreaking study published in Nature Communications analysed more than
7,000 bus routes across 36 cities and reached a startling conclusion: the informal
minibus networks of the Global South are often more efficient than the centrally
planned systems of the Global North.
This is not to romanticise the sector. The Nature Communications study
acknowledges that informal services often suffer from poor vehicle safety, unreliable
scheduling, and minimal driver training. But the structural efficiency of their route
networks suggests that simply bulldozing these systems in favour of rigid, centrally
planned alternatives is a mistake. The goal should be integration and formalisation
that preserves adaptability while improving safety and reliability.
Underpinning all these challenges is a crisis of leadership and institutional memory.
The Norman Broadbent report makes a pointed observation: transport organisations
are finally recognising that “succession planning must be treated as a programme
risk, not an HR afterthoughtโ. When a visionary director leaves and takes decades of
relationships and tacit knowledge with them, projects stall. When political cycles turn
over every four or five years, long-term programmes are chopped and changed
beyond recognition.
Copenhagen, widely regarded as a sustainability pioneer, illustrates the tension.
Research on the city’s Sustainable Urban Mobility Plan found that even in this most
favourable of environments, “conflicting political priorities and car dominance hamper
ambitious planning”. If Copenhagen struggles to maintain momentum, what hope for
cities without its institutional capacity and civic consensus?
The bottlenecks in public transport are not technical problems awaiting a
technological magic bullet. They are human problems: fragmentation, inertia, short-
termism, and the eternal difficulty of getting different people with different incentives
to row in the same direction. The solutions, therefore, must be equally human. They
require governance reforms that clarify accountability without stifling local input. They
demand investment in the boring but essential work of data systems and digital
management. They call for humility in the face of informal systems that have evolved
to meet needs that central planners cannot see. And above all, they require a
commitment to leadership continuity and institutional memory that transcends
electoral cycles.
